I generally keep a flavor to a tank. When I get a new flavor, I get a new tank to put it in. That said, I still have to change a flavor in a tank once in a while.

Remove your head from your tank, drain the tank, rinse under hot water, set aside to dry. Remove the coil from the head, rinse and dry the head. Pull the top post from the coil, remove the upper wick, rinse the wicks and coil (I use a Water Pik for this, makes the task lightning quick), blot and dry. Reassemble and put your new flavor in, just like a new tank, no crossover taste.

Once a week I'll disassemble and soak my parts in a 2:1 solution of white vinegar and water overnight. Gets it all squeaky clean, just be sure to THOROUGHLY rinse the vinegar out. Vape vinegar once, you'll never wanna do it again!

I know what other posters meant when they told you to keep the same flavor in. I once had a brand new ce4 (not ce5) that I rinsed out ONCE. It never worked again. So with that said, I would attempt to do what Blkwdw86 suggests but proceed with caution. Those heads are not as sturdy as others. You may want to look into other options eventually.
